Abstract
The present invention is directed to multi-layer golf balls having a center, a cover layer, and at least one intermediate layer between the core and the cover layer. The center, the at least one intermediate layer and the cover are constructed to have different initial velocities and COR such that the gradients of initial velocities and COR progress from a slower center to a faster cover.
